Pricing of RX 8800 XT in 2026
In 2026, the AMD RX 8800 XT is generally priced between $699 and $799. This range reflects variations based on manufacturer, cooling solutions, and availability. AMD continues to position the RX 8800 XT as a value-oriented choice, providing high performance at a relatively lower price point compared to Nvidia’s offerings.
Pricing of Nvidia GeForce Series in 2026
The Nvidia GeForce series, especially the flagship RTX 5090, commands a higher price. In 2026, the RTX 5090 typically retails around $1,499 to $1,699. Lower-tier models like the RTX 5080 and RTX 5070 are priced between $799 and $1,099. Nvidia’s premium pricing reflects its advanced features, including superior ray tracing and AI-driven enhancements.
Price Comparison Summary
- AMD RX 8800 XT: $699 – $799
- Nvidia RTX 5090: $1,499 – $1,699
- Mid-range Nvidia models: $799 – $1,099
